[Q] Help: Camera Failure

Have AT&T GS3 I747 that took a swim. Was able to rescue it, but lost the camera. Tried most everything I could find searching here and elswhere, and finally decided to replace the camera hardware (rear facing, front facing works fine).
Got the new camera installed, and still get the camera failed notice when starting up the TW camera app.
Wondering if it may be driver related. I am running deTmobilized 1.3 ROM, and it behaves the same as the stock UCDLK3 for this error.
Is there perhaps another component that might be causing this, or a way to update to newer camera drivers?
Everything else on the phone works perfectly, but it sure would be great to get the rear facing camera back up and running.
Things I have tried:
Force closure and wipe camera app cache.
Alternate camera apps.
Reinstall old camera.
Anybody think they can provide some guidance?

I have tried 3 different ROMS (stock UCDLK3, rooted UCDLK3, and deTmobilized 1.3.
I have also tried all these with both the original back facing camera hardware, and the new camera hardware.
With the original camera hardware, I can get a camera firmware check to complete with *#34971539#. With the new camera hardware, the factory test fails with attempting to run the camera firmware check key sequence. Here is the screenshot foom the camera firmware check that does run to completion.

Just tried the nightly of CM, and no luck with camera working. Gallery would not start. Looking more and more like a board level hardware problem. I have a copy of the GT-I9300 service manual which has a troubleshooting flowchart for the 8M camera. If I can rig a test jig and get a scope, maybe I can try that. It requires checking voltages at 6 points on the MB, and also a frequency check at one point.
